Townhall Review – August 22, 2020

Hugh Hewitt and Arkansas Senator Tom Cotton talk about an allegation that Postmaster General DeJoy was colluding with President Trump to slow down the processing of mail-in voting in November.

Joe Piscopo talks with Corey Lewandowski, senior advisor to the Trump Campaign, about the Democratic National Convention.

Hugh Hewitt and Jessica Patterson, Chair of the California GOP, talk regaining congressional seats in California.

Chris Stigall talks with David Rubin about the peace deal between Israel and the United Arab Emirates.

Chris Stigall and U.S. Attorney Andrew McCarthy talk about the indictment of former FBI Attorney Kevin Clinesmith accused of fabricating evidence.

Dennis Prager talks with Alex Epstein, energy consultant and author of “The Moral Cause for Fossil Fuels,’ about the Democrats push for the “Green New Deal.”

Dennis Prager talks with Dr. Paul Kengor about his book, “The Devil and Karl Marx.”

Seth Leibsohn takes a look at a recent column by Corey Brooks, Senior Pastor at New Beginnings Church of Chicago and CEO of Project H.O.O.D. Communities Development Corporation.
